During a ski vacation in Telluride this month, I noted that realtors are listing the former Rio Grande Southern RR depot for sale. The station is nicely restored and has been used as a restaurant. The offering brochure also suggests the depot would make a fine ski lodge since it is only two blocks from the gondola. The asking price -- a cool $4.5 million.
The RGS Receiver got just a little over $400,000 when the entire 162 mile RGS mainline went for scrap in 1952. The various parcels of RGS property like the Telluride depot went for peanuts. Fifty years makes a heck of a difference.
